Colombian family food company and dominant leader of Bogotá's arepa market (~70% share) — founded Aug 17, 1992 by two brothers from Sonson, Antioquia (Luis Alberto & Luis Alfonso Valencia) and their wives, who started selling handmade arepas from bicycles via a consignment model. Today: 9 plants in Bogotá & Medellín, 1M+ arepas/day, full vertical integration — 2,000 ha of own corn (Pioneer seeds), own mill, 400+ employees, ~$8M revenue (31.3B COP, 2023), no external investors. Exporter to the US (since 1999), Australia and England; state-recognized ESG model: 578 solar panels, 30% electric fleet. Tragedy: Nov 2024 — co-founder Luis Alfonso was murdered at his ranch by an insider who had spent 2 months profiling the property; both killers got 36 years in 2025, and the business never stopped.
